Quick retirement planning note for the federal employees and military servicemen and ladies out there. Starting in January 2026, you'll have the ability to do Roth in-plan conversions in your Thrift Cost Savings Plan (TSP). To put it simply, you will now have the ability to transform money from your standard (pre-tax) balance to your Roth (after-tax) balance.
If you have a TSP, I 'd highly recommend doing some planning work with your tax and financial advisor to see how it would affect your longer-term tax plan.
SPB premiums cost as much as 6.5% of your pension so that your making it through spouse can declare as much as 55% of your pensions. Those premiums are non-refundable and can add up gradually. Nevertheless, the guaranteed, inflation-adjusted income it provides to your spouse might be tough to duplicate with private insurance, making it an important alternative for lots of households, specifically those without other survivor income sources.
